Once a design is completed, the board goes into pcb fabrication. This is the manufacturing process that produces the bare printed circuit board before components are included. Pcb fabrication manufacturers and pcb manufacturers shape the board from materials such as FR4, Rogers laminates, polyimide, aluminum, ceramic pcb materials, or metal core pcb material relying on the application. FR4 is typical due to the fact that it is budget-friendly, steady, and widely offered, yet high frequency pcb and hdi pcb layouts may call for specific materials with controlled dielectric properties. Throughout pcb fabrication, layers of copper are laminated to insulating material, openings are drilled or lasered, vias are developed, and surfaces are completed with choices such as HASL or ENIG. When individuals ask “how are circuit boards made” or “what are pcb boards made from,” the response is a split mix of protecting substrate, copper traces, and safety surface finishes.

Pcb assembly is the next major step, where components are placed onto the made board. In useful terms, pcba vs pcb is simple: the pcb is the bare board, while the pcba is the completed board with components set up. There are several kinds of circuit card buildings. Rigid pcb is the standard format used in most devices, while flexible pcb, flex pcb, flexible printed circuit card, and flex circuits permit the board to bend or fold up. Flexible motherboard manufacturers and flex circuit manufacturers create these boards for wearable devices, electronic cameras, medical tools, and small electronics. Rigid flex pcb and rigid flex circuit designs combine flexible and rigid sections right into one assembly, which saves space and boosts dependability in systems that need motion or complex kind aspects. Flexible printed circuits and flex circuit board products are beneficial in applications where repeated motion is called for. Even curved pcb and bendable motherboard styles have actually come to be a lot more usual as product units end up being more advanced.
